A sales trainer is a professional who specializes in providing training and guidance to sales teams or individuals to enhance their selling skills, increase productivity, and achieve sales targets. They design and deliver training programs that focus on various aspects of the sales process, including prospecting, lead generation, negotiation, closing deals, and building client relationships. Sales trainers assess the strengths and weaknesses of salespeople and tailor their training methods accordingly, using techniques such as role-playing, interactive workshops, and one-on-one coaching sessions. They also stay updated with the latest sales strategies and industry trends to ensure that the training content remains relevant and effective.

Sales Trainer salary in Ghana
Average Yearly Salary of Sales Trainer in Ghana is approximately 55,046 GHS (4,582 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
